VHDL赋值语句

来源:本站
导读:目前正在解读《VHDL赋值语句》的相关信息,《VHDL赋值语句》是由用户自行发布的知识型内容!下面请观看由(电工学习网 - www.9pbb.com)用户发布《VHDL赋值语句》的详细说明。

赋值语句分信号赋值语句和变量赋值语句两种。

每一种都有下面三个基本组成部分:赋值目标:是所赋值的受体,它的基本元素只能是信号或变量。赋值符号:是赋值符号只有两种。一种是信号赋值符号”<=”;另一VHDL赋值语句种是变量赋值符号”:=”。赋值源:赋值源是赋值的主体,它可以是一个数值,也可以是一个逻辑或运算表达式。

注意:VHDL规定赋值目标与赋值源的数据类型必须严格一致。

变量赋值与信号赋值的区别:变量具有局部特征,它的有效性只局限于所定义的一个进程中,或一个子程序中,它是一个局部的、暂时性数据对象,对于它的赋值是立即发生的。信号具有全局特征,它不但可以作为一个设计实体内部各单元之间数据传送的载体,而且可通过信号与其他的实体进行通信,信号的赋值不是立即发生的,它发生在一个进程结束时。

提醒:《VHDL赋值语句》最后刷新时间 2023-07-10 03:51:47,本站为公益型个人网站,仅供个人学习和记录信息,不进行任何商业性质的盈利。如果内容、图片资源失效或内容涉及侵权,请反馈至,我们会及时处理。本站只保证内容的可读性,无法保证真实性,《VHDL赋值语句》该内容的真实性请自行鉴别。